网站防篡改:立即部署WEB应用防火墙的必要性与实践指南
2025.09.08 10:34浏览量:0简介:本文详细探讨了网站防篡改的重要性,分析了当前面临的网络安全威胁,并提供了立即部署WEB应用防火墙(WAF)的实践指南,包括技术原理、部署步骤和最佳实践,帮助开发者和企业有效提升网站安全性。
引言
在数字化时代,网站已成为企业和个人展示形象、提供服务的重要窗口。然而,随着网络攻击手段的日益复杂,网站防篡改成为了一个不可忽视的安全问题。恶意攻击者可能通过篡改网站内容、注入恶意代码或窃取用户数据,对企业和用户造成严重损失。为了应对这些威胁,立即部署WEB应用防火墙(WAF)成为了一种高效且必要的解决方案。本文将深入探讨网站防篡改的重要性,并详细介绍如何通过部署WAF来提升网站安全性。
一、网站防篡改的重要性
保护企业声誉:网站是企业对外展示的窗口,一旦被篡改,可能导致用户信任度下降,甚至引发公关危机。例如,攻击者可能在网站上发布虚假信息或恶意链接,误导用户。
防止数据泄露:篡改攻击往往伴随着数据窃取。攻击者可能通过注入恶意代码窃取用户敏感信息,如登录凭证、支付信息等,给用户和企业带来巨大风险。
避免法律风险:许多国家和地区对数据安全和隐私保护有严格的法律要求。网站被篡改可能导致企业违反相关法规,面临法律诉讼和罚款。
确保业务连续性:篡改攻击可能导致网站服务中断,影响正常业务运营。例如,攻击者可能通过篡改网站内容或破坏服务器,使网站无法访问。
二、当前网站面临的主要威胁
SQL注入:攻击者通过注入恶意SQL代码,绕过身份验证或窃取数据库信息。例如:
SELECT * FROM users WHERE username = 'admin' OR '1'='1';
这种攻击可能导致数据库信息泄露。
跨站脚本(XSS):攻击者在网页中注入恶意脚本,当用户访问该页面时,脚本会在用户浏览器中执行,窃取用户信息或劫持会话。
跨站请求伪造(CSRF):攻击者诱使用户在不知情的情况下提交恶意请求,例如转账或修改账户信息。
文件包含漏洞:攻击者通过包含恶意文件,执行任意代码或读取敏感文件。
DDoS攻击:通过大量请求淹没服务器,导致网站无法正常提供服务。
三、WEB应用防火墙(WAF)的工作原理
WEB应用防火墙(WAF)是一种专门用于保护网站免受常见攻击的安全解决方案。它通过以下方式工作:
流量过滤:WAF分析所有传入的HTTP/HTTPS请求,根据预定义的规则集过滤恶意流量。例如,它可以检测并阻止包含SQL注入或XSS攻击的请求。
规则引擎:WAF使用规则引擎匹配已知的攻击模式。这些规则可以基于OWASP Top 10等安全标准,也可以根据企业需求自定义。
行为分析:一些高级WAF还具备行为分析能力,能够识别异常流量模式,例如突然增加的请求频率或异常的请求参数。
日志与报告:WAF记录所有拦截的请求,生成详细的安全报告,帮助管理员分析攻击趋势并优化安全策略。
四、立即部署WAF的必要性
快速响应威胁:WAF可以实时拦截攻击,无需等待服务器或应用程序的更新。这对于零日漏洞尤为重要。
低成本高效益:相比于修复被攻击后的损失,部署WAF的成本更低。它可以防止数据泄露、服务中断等严重后果。
合规要求:许多行业标准(如PCI DSS)要求企业部署WAF以保护用户数据。立即部署WAF有助于满足这些合规要求。
灵活性与可扩展性:WAF可以轻松集成到现有基础设施中,支持云部署、本地部署或混合部署,适应不同规模的企业需求。
五、如何部署WEB应用防火墙
选择适合的WAF解决方案:
- 云WAF:适合中小型企业,无需维护硬件,快速部署。
- 硬件WAF:适合大型企业,提供更高的性能和定制化能力。
- 开源WAF:如ModSecurity,适合技术团队较强的企业。
配置规则集:
- 启用OWASP核心规则集(CRS),覆盖常见攻击类型。
- 根据业务需求自定义规则,例如屏蔽特定IP或限制某些请求方法。
集成与测试:
- 将WAF部署到网站流量入口,确保所有请求都经过WAF过滤。
- 进行渗透测试,验证WAF的有效性。例如,尝试SQL注入或XSS攻击,确认WAF能够拦截。
监控与优化:
- 定期查看WAF日志,分析拦截的请求。
- 根据实际攻击情况调整规则,减少误报和漏报。
六、WAF部署的最佳实践
分层防御:WAF应作为安全体系的一部分,与其他安全措施(如防火墙、入侵检测系统)结合使用。
定期更新规则:攻击手段不断演变,WAF规则也应定期更新以应对新威胁。
性能优化:WAF可能引入一定的延迟,需通过缓存、负载均衡等技术优化性能。
培训与意识:确保开发团队和安全团队了解WAF的工作原理,能够正确处理安全事件。
七、常见问题与解决方案
误报问题:某些合法请求可能被WAF拦截。解决方案是通过日志分析,调整规则或添加白名单。
性能瓶颈:高流量场景下,WAF可能成为性能瓶颈。解决方案是选择高性能WAF或启用流量分流。
规则管理复杂性:随着规则数量增加,管理难度加大。解决方案是使用规则分组和自动化工具。
八、结语
网站防篡改是网络安全的重要组成部分,而立即部署WEB应用防火墙(WAF)是应对这一挑战的有效手段。通过理解WAF的工作原理、部署步骤和最佳实践,企业和开发者可以显著提升网站的安全性,保护用户数据和企业声誉。在日益复杂的网络威胁环境中,主动采取安全措施不再是可选项,而是必选项。
发表评论
登录后可评论,请前往 登录 或 注册